Brian David Kitney serves as an Independent Director.

Mr. Kitney is a seasoned professional with over 30 years of expertise in the energy industry, having held pivotal roles in renowned Japanese companies, including Osaka Gas (Australia) Ltd, Mitsui & Co (Australia) Ltd, and JPMorgan Securities (Japan). Throughout his career, he has excelled in business development, marketing, and executive leadership. Mr. Kitney has recently immersed himself in future-energy domains, particularly focusing on LNG, hydrogen, carbon capture and storage (CCS), and renewables.

His comprehensive knowledge extends to supporting developers and investors in originating and developing targeted investment opportunities. Engagements involve providing commercial advice for LNG terminals, hydrogen solutions, offshore wind assets, and oil and gas projects across Australia and Southeast Asia. Brian?s academic accomplishments include an MBA from Curtin University, a Graduate Diploma of Applied Finance from Kaplan, a Graduate Diploma in Diplomacy & International Trade from Monash University, a Diploma of Financial Markets from AFMA, a Master of Applied Japanese Linguistics from Monash University, and a Post Graduate Diploma in Japanese from Swinburne University.
